Your map (of Napier Barracks) refreshed my memory on a number of points and allowed me to remember some areas more clearly.
For example the old
firing bays on the way up to the pond where Ken Macklin and I tried to launch the model cabin cruiser that we had built during the
spring and early summer of 1959.
When we first discovered the pond in February it looked ideal for model boating. We worked
industriously for four months, took our creation for a cruise in June only to find the pond fringed with weed. Undaunted we set the
thing off - it went about two feet before stalling. We recovered it but not before the motor had become very hot - we didn't try again.
